WHAT YOU'LL ACTUALLY BE DOING
▪ Assist the Superintendent and Project Manager with day-to-day field operations
▪ Take field measurements and layout, and help verify work matches drawings and specifications
▪ Maintain daily field reports, logs, and jobsite documentation
▪ Track material deliveries and help coordinate with subcontractors on-site
▪ Support quality control walk-throughs and help maintain punch lists
▪ Take progress photos and help keep project records organized and current
▪ Learn and help enforce jobsite safety standards
▪ Support scheduling updates and help track project milestones
▪ Assist with as-built drawings and closeout documentation
